A business dashboard is a visual representation of key performance indicators (KPIs) and other relevant data that provides a comprehensive view of a business’s performance. The best business dashboard software can help businesses track their progress against goals, identify trends, and make better decisions.

Business dashboards have become increasingly important in recent years as businesses have become more data-driven. By providing a centralized view of key data, dashboards can help businesses improve their decision-making, increase efficiency, and gain a competitive advantage.

There are many different types of business dashboard software available, each with its own unique features and benefits. Some of the most popular types of dashboard software include:

  • Financial dashboards
  • Sales dashboards
  • Marketing dashboards
  • Customer service dashboards
  • Operational dashboards

The best business dashboard software for a particular business will depend on its specific needs and requirements. However, all businesses can benefit from using dashboard software to improve their performance.

Customization

Customization is a key aspect of the best business dashboard software. It allows businesses to tailor their dashboards to meet their specific needs and goals. This is important because every business is unique, with its own unique set of metrics and KPIs. A dashboard that is customized to a specific business will be more effective in helping that business track its progress and make better decisions.

  • Facet 1: Business-Specific Metrics
    Dashboards can be customized to track the metrics that are most important to a specific business. For example, a retail business might want to track sales, customer traffic, and average order value. A manufacturing business might want to track production output, quality control, and inventory levels.
  • Facet 2: Visual Layouts
    Dashboards can be customized to use different visual layouts. This allows businesses to choose the layout that best suits their needs. For example, a business might want to use a simple bar chart to track sales, or a more complex scatter plot to track customer behavior.
  • Facet 3: Data Sources
    Dashboards can be customized to connect to different data sources. This allows businesses to consolidate all of their data into one place. For example, a business might want to connect its dashboard to its CRM system, its ERP system, and its social media accounts.
  • Facet 4: User Permissions
    Dashboards can be customized to give different users different levels of access. This allows businesses to control who can see what data. For example, a business might want to give sales managers access to sales data, but not to financial data.

Customization is essential for getting the most out of business dashboard software. By tailoring their dashboards to their specific needs, businesses can improve their decision-making, increase efficiency, and gain a competitive advantage.

Visual insights

Visual insights are a critical component of the best business dashboard software. They allow businesses to present data in easy-to-understand formats, such as charts and graphs. This makes it easier for businesses to identify trends, patterns, and outliers.

  • Facet 1: Improved Decision-Making
    Visual insights can help businesses make better decisions by making it easier to see how different variables are related. For example, a business might use a scatter plot to see how sales are related to marketing spend. This information can be used to make decisions about how to allocate marketing resources.
  • Facet 2: Faster Problem Identification
    Visual insights can help businesses identify problems faster by making it easier to see where there are deviations from the norm. For example, a business might use a line chart to track website traffic. If there is a sudden drop in traffic, the business can use visual insights to identify the cause of the drop.
  • Facet 3: Enhanced Communication
    Visual insights can help businesses communicate more effectively with stakeholders by making it easier to share data in a clear and concise way. For example, a business might use a dashboard to share key performance indicators (KPIs) with investors. The dashboard can be customized to include the most relevant KPIs and to present the data in a way that is easy to understand.
  • Facet 4: Increased Efficiency
    Visual insights can help businesses increase efficiency by making it easier to find the information they need. For example, a business might use a dashboard to track the status of different projects. The dashboard can be customized to include the most relevant information and to present the data in a way that is easy to scan.

Overall, visual insights are an essential component of the best business dashboard software. They allow businesses to make better decisions, identify problems faster, communicate more effectively with stakeholders, and increase efficiency.

Best Business Dashboard Software Tips

Incorporating best business dashboard software into your organization can provide numerous benefits, including improved decision-making, increased efficiency, enhanced collaboration, and better insights into business performance. Here are some tips to help you get started:

Tip 1: Define Your Goals
Before selecting and implementing business dashboard software, clearly define your goals and objectives. Determine the specific metrics and KPIs that are most important to your organization and align the dashboard’s functionality with those goals.Tip 2: Choose the Right Software
Carefully evaluate different business dashboard software options and select the one that best meets your specific needs and requirements. Consider factors such as customization capabilities, data integration options, visual presentation features, and the level of support provided.Tip 3: Implement Effectively
Proper implementation is crucial for successful dashboard adoption. Provide adequate training to users and ensure that they understand how to interpret and utilize the data effectively. Establish a regular cadence for updating and reviewing the dashboard to maintain its accuracy and relevance.Tip 4: Encourage Collaboration
Promote collaboration and knowledge sharing by enabling users to share dashboards and insights with colleagues. Foster a culture where data-driven decision-making is valued and encouraged at all levels of the organization.Tip 5: Focus on Visual Clarity
Design dashboards with visual clarity as a top priority. Use intuitive charts, graphs, and other visualizations to make data easily understandable and actionable. Avoid overwhelming users with excessive data or complex visuals.Tip 6: Keep it Relevant
Regularly review and update the dashboard to ensure that it remains relevant to your organization’s evolving needs and priorities. Remove outdated or redundant metrics and add new ones as necessary to maintain the dashboard’s effectiveness.Tip 7: Seek Continuous Improvement
Continuously seek feedback from users and identify areas for improvement. Explore new features and functionality offered by your dashboard software and consider user suggestions to enhance its capabilities and value.Tip 8: Ensure Data Security
Prioritize data security by implementing robust measures to protect sensitive business information. Choose software with strong security features and establish clear policies and procedures for data access and management.By following these tips, you can leverage best business dashboard software to its full potential and gain valuable insights that drive better decision-making, improve performance, and ultimately achieve business success.
